[0001] This invention relates to the field of drug tube inspection technology, and more specifically, to a drug tube visual inspection device that integrates multiple parameter detection functions such as drug tube appearance, concentricity, cut and length. Background Technology

[0002] As a core component of pyrotechnic devices, explosive charges are widely used in civil blasting, military, and other fields. Their quality directly affects their safety and detonation reliability. Appearance defects (such as scratches, damage, stains, and exposed core), concentricity deviation, cut smoothness, and length accuracy are key indicators of their quality, thus requiring rigorous testing of these parameters.

[0003] Currently, traditional drug testing mostly relies on manual methods, with inspectors relying on visual observation and simple tools to complete the testing. This method has several drawbacks, such as: 1. Low testing efficiency, making it difficult to meet the testing needs of large-scale production; 2. High testing accuracy is greatly affected by human factors, is highly subjective, and prone to missed or false detections, especially for subtle parameters like concentricity, where accuracy is difficult to guarantee. Deviations in drug concentricity can lead to uneven combustion rates, posing safety hazards; 3. Manual testing is labor-intensive, and prolonged work can easily lead to fatigue, further reducing testing reliability. Furthermore, direct contact with the drug poses certain safety risks.

[0004] To address the drawbacks of manual inspection, some automated inspection equipment has emerged on the market. However, most existing equipment is single-function, often only capable of visual inspection or single-dimensional parameter testing. To complete comprehensive testing of multiple parameters of tubing, multiple different inspection devices are required. This not only increases equipment investment costs and floor space but also necessitates multiple loading and unloading operations, prolonging the inspection process and reducing production efficiency. Furthermore, during multi-device inspection, repeated positioning of tubing can introduce errors, affecting the consistency of inspection accuracy, and frequent transfers may damage the tubing surface. [0024] To address the problems of limited functionality, low efficiency, insufficient accuracy, and inadequate safety in existing gunpowder testing equipment, this invention provides a visual inspection device capable of detecting the appearance, concentricity, cuts, and length of gunpowder tubes (cylinders are cylindrical objects composed of gunpowder). The visual inspection device provided by this invention forms a complete visual inspection system by setting up appearance inspection stations, concentricity inspection stations, cut inspection stations, and length inspection stations, achieving simultaneous multi-parameter detection, improving inspection efficiency and accuracy, and reducing inspection costs and safety risks.

[0025] The present invention provides a tube visual inspection device capable of detecting the appearance, concentricity, cuts, and length of tube medicines. The device includes a conveyor line mechanism (the conveyor line mechanism includes a frame, a circulating conveyor belt on the frame, and a pallet on the conveyor belt), a loading and unloading robot (in one specific embodiment of the present invention, the robot includes a spider arm, which is the Delta parallel robot robot in the field of industrial technology. It is named for its resemblance to a spider with many legs and is a special robot for high-speed sorting, grasping, and handling), a visual inspection mechanism, a rejection device, and a control system.

[0026] The robotic arms used for loading and unloading are located at the starting end (also known as the loading end) and the recycling end of the conveyor system. The robotic arm at the starting end picks up the tubes to be tested from the hopper and accurately places them onto the trays of the conveyor system. (In embodiments with a sorting conveyor belt, the robotic arm primarily removes the tubes from the hopper and transfers them to the sorting conveyor belt, which then transports them one by one to the trays of the conveyor system.) The robotic arm at the recycling end picks up qualified tubes from the trays of the conveyor system and moves them to the qualified product recycling area. Through the cooperation of the robotic arms and the conveyor system, the entire process of tube testing—loading and recycling—is automated, reducing direct human contact and improving safety.

[0027] In one specific embodiment of the present invention, the robotic arm includes a multi-axis robot body, an end effector (spider hand), and a vision positioning component. The multi-axis robot body adopts a four-axis parallel robot structure, fixed on a frame, with a repeatability accuracy of ±0.01mm, fast motion response speed, and smooth movement. The end effector is an adaptive pneumatic gripper-type spider hand, with silicone anti-slip pads embedded on the inner side of the grippers. The gripping force adjustment range is 3-30N, which can automatically adjust the force according to the diameter of the drug tube to avoid damaging the drug tube surface or squeezing the drug core during gripping, while ensuring gripping stability. The vision positioning component consists of a binocular positioning camera and a positioning lens. The positioning camera is integrated into the robot body via a bracket, and the positioning lens faces the hopper, the starting end of the conveyor line mechanism, and the recycling area (recycling end and rejection area), respectively, to collect real-time coordinate information of the drug tube position, the V-groove station of the conveyor line (the V-groove set on the bracket of the conveyor line mechanism to stably hold the drug tube), and the recycling bin. The data is transmitted to the control system to guide the spider hand to complete precise gripping and placement actions.

[0028] The conveyor system includes a frame, which is a straight frame structure. The conveyor system also includes a conveyor belt, which is set along the length of the frame and is the core transmission component connecting each inspection station. Its core function is to drive the tubing to be transported one by one in a preset order to the visual inspection station corresponding to the appearance inspection station (or appearance and curvature inspection station), concentricity inspection station, cut inspection station, and length inspection station. After the accurate detection of each parameter is completed, the tubing is transported to the recycling end or rejection area.

[0029] The conveyor system includes a stepper motor, a synchronous belt conveyor assembly, and V-groove positioning components (i.e., the aforementioned brackets). The stepper motor is fixed to the bottom of the frame and connected to the synchronous belt conveyor assembly via a reducer, enabling stepless adjustment of the conveying speed to ensure smooth transmission and match the inspection rhythm of each station. V-groove positioning components (brackets) are evenly spaced on the synchronous belt of the synchronous belt conveyor assembly. These V-groove positioning components are integrally molded from anti-static nylon material, with polished inner walls. They are adaptable to different specifications of tubes and utilize the self-centering characteristic of the V-groove structure to automatically center and fix the tubes, ensuring the stability of the central axis as the tubes pass through each visual inspection station, preventing deviation from affecting inspection accuracy. Simultaneously, the anti-static material prevents static electricity generation, meeting the safety requirements for pyrotechnics inspection.

[0030] The conveyor line mechanism is divided along the conveying direction in the following order: "feeding station → appearance inspection station → concentricity inspection station → cut inspection station → length inspection station → rejection station → recycling station". Each station is equipped with a position sensor to provide real-time feedback on the position of the medicine tube to the control system, ensuring that the medicine tube accurately reaches each visual inspection station and triggers the inspection action.

[0031] As can be seen from the above, the present invention has multiple detection stations set along the conveying direction of the conveyor line mechanism. The tube medicine is conveyed one by one by matching the conveying speed of the conveyor line mechanism. Each detection station is equipped with at least one trigger sensor. When the trigger sensor (laser sensor, mainly used to detect whether the tube medicine has been conveyed to the position) of the detection station detects the tube medicine, the trigger sensor is triggered, and the PLC controller controls the detection camera of the corresponding station to perform image acquisition.

[0032] The visual inspection mechanism is set up at each visual inspection station of the corresponding conveyor line mechanism to form a complete multi-parameter inspection system. Specifically, it includes an appearance inspection component that matches the appearance inspection station, a concentricity inspection component that matches the concentricity inspection station, a cut inspection component that matches the cut inspection station, a length inspection component that matches the length inspection station, and a dedicated light source component that provides an adaptive light source for each component. Each inspection component corresponds to its corresponding station to ensure that accurate inspection is started synchronously when the medicine arrives at the station.

[0033] The appearance inspection component (or appearance and curvature inspection component 9) is installed at the appearance inspection station and includes four symmetrically arranged industrial cameras. These cameras are mounted on the conveyor line via a gantry frame (composed of an X-shaped mounting plate and mounting shaft), with their lenses facing the circumference of the drug tube within the V-groove. Combined with a low-power surround ring light source, it can simultaneously acquire appearance images of the upper and lower halves of the drug tube, accurately identifying defects such as surface cracks, scratches, fish-scale patterns, pitting, damage, stains, exposed drug core, and bulges, achieving comprehensive inspection without blind spots. Simultaneously, it calculates whether the curvature of the drug tube is within acceptable limits.

[0034] The concentricity detection component 10 is set at the concentricity detection station and consists of an industrial camera, a telecentric lens, and a backlight. The backlight and the industrial camera are located on opposite sides of the conveyor line and are coaxially arranged. The parallel light emitted by the backlight penetrates the drug tube to form a contour projection. After the industrial camera acquires the projected image, it is transmitted to the control system. By extracting the contour coordinates of the outer skin and the core of the drug tube, their center positions are calculated, thereby obtaining the concentricity deviation. The detection accuracy reaches ±0.005mm, avoiding uneven combustion caused by concentricity difference.

[0035] The cut inspection component 11 is set at the cut inspection station. It uses an industrial camera with a high-resolution lens, which is set vertically toward the end of the tube. The lens focus is aligned with the cut plane. It is illuminated by a high-brightness strip light source (soft light without direct glare) to highlight the characteristics of the cut, such as burrs, chips, and flatness, to ensure clear imaging of defects and avoid the cut defects from affecting the assembly sealing.

[0036] The length detection component 12 is installed at the length detection station and includes an industrial camera and a high-resolution telecentric lens. The telecentric lens's field of view covers the entire axial length of the propellant tube. A calibration scale is parallel to the propellant tube and fixed beside the conveyor line as a length measurement reference. Length accuracy of ±0.02mm is achieved through image pixel comparison to ensure that the propellant tube length meets detonation requirements. Each industrial camera communicates with the control system in real time via an explosion-proof image acquisition card.

[0037] The rejection device is installed at the rejection station of the conveyor line mechanism to remove unqualified medicine tubes determined by the control system from the conveyor line. The rejection device includes an explosion-proof rejection cylinder, a pusher block, a defective product chute, and an anti-static waste box. The rejection cylinder is fixed to the conveyor line by an insulating bracket. The pusher block is connected to the cylinder piston rod, and its end has an arc shape adapted to the medicine tube. It is made of soft rubber to avoid damaging the medicine tube or generating static electricity during rejection. The defective product chute is made of anti-static PVC material, with a 30° inclination angle, corresponding to the pusher block. The end of the chute is connected to the waste box, which contains an anti-static cushioning pad and is grounded to prevent static electricity accumulation. When the unqualified medicine tube reaches the rejection station, the position sensor sends a signal, and the control system controls the rejection cylinder to move. The pusher block smoothly pushes the medicine tube from the V-groove into the defective product chute, where it falls into the waste box. After rejection, the cylinder quickly resets, without affecting subsequent medicine tube conveying. The control system is the core control unit of the entire device, electrically connected to the robotic arm, conveyor line mechanism, various vision inspection mechanisms, and rejection devices to achieve coordinated operation of these mechanisms. The system also features anti-static and explosion-proof control characteristics. The control system includes an industrial computer, a PLC controller, a human-machine interface, and a data storage module. The industrial computer integrates an image processing module and a motion control module to perform defect identification, parameter calculation, and conformity judgment on images acquired by various industrial cameras. The accuracy rate for identifying key defects such as exposed drug cores and damaged outer skin in drug tubes is ≥99.8%. The motion control module generates the optimal motion trajectory for the spider arm based on the coordinate data from the vision positioning components, ensuring smooth and shock-free movement. The PLC controller is responsible for controlling the start, stop, and speed of the conveyor line stepper motors, the opening and closing of the spider arm's pneumatic grippers, the switching of various detection light sources, and the timing of the rejection cylinder's actions. The response time of each actuator (the mechanism requiring PLC control in this application) is ≤1ms. The human-machine interface uses an explosion-proof touchscreen, which can display real-time detection data, equipment operating status, defect type statistics, and other information, and supports the custom setting and storage of detection parameters. The data storage module can automatically record the test results of each tube, including defect images, dimensional parameters, test time, operator information, etc. The data can be exported or uploaded to the MES system via explosion-proof Ethernet to achieve full-process traceability of production quality.

[0042] Specifically, the principle of this invention for surface defect detection is: local texture anomaly analysis; the principle for curvature detection is: central axis fitting and curvature calculation; the principle for concentricity detection is: biorthogonal projection circle center offset composite image analysis; and the principle for cut end face detection is: end face flatness and core exposure analysis.

[0044] In this invention, the drug delivery visual inspection device operates as follows: 1. Loading Stage: The tubes to be tested are placed in batches into an anti-static hopper. The robotic arm uses a vision positioning component to collect the three-dimensional position data of the tubes within the hopper, transmitting this data to the motion control module of the control system to generate a gripping trajectory. When the robotic arm uses a spider-arm approach, the multi-axis robot body drives the end effector to move to the target tube position. The pneumatic gripper adaptively adjusts its gripping force to complete the gripping, then precisely places the tube into the V-groove positioning component at the beginning of the conveyor line. The spider-arm then returns to the hopper for the next gripping operation. When the robotic arm uses a gantry crane + overhead crane + negative pressure suction cup approach, the movement of the overhead crane is controlled so that the negative pressure suction cup aligns with the tube and descends to absorb it. This control method is simpler than the spider-arm approach.

[0045] 2. Conveying and Inspection Stage: The control system starts the stepper motor of the conveyor line, and the V-groove (pallet) drives the tubing to move along the conveying direction, entering each inspection station sequentially according to the preset order of the visual inspection stations: "Appearance Inspection Station → Concentricity Inspection Station → Cut Inspection Station → Length Inspection Station". When the tubing reaches a certain inspection station, the position sensor of that station immediately sends a signal, triggering the corresponding inspection component to start the image acquisition and inspection process. After the inspection of the current station is completed, the conveyor line carries the tubing to the next inspection station, realizing the orderly and accurate detection of various parameters. Image data is transmitted to the industrial computer in real time, and the image processing module simultaneously completes defect identification and parameter calculation, and stores the pass / fail judgment results; the conveying speed between stations can be adjusted according to the inspection requirements to avoid affecting the inspection accuracy.

[0046] 3. Rejection Stage: After completing full parameter testing, the tubes arrive at the rejection station along the conveyor line. The control system calls up the judgment result of the tube. If it is a defective product, the PLC controller controls the corresponding rejection cylinder to act, and the pusher block smoothly pushes the tube into the defective product chute, where it falls into a special waste box. If it is a qualified product, the rejection device does not act, and the tube continues to move along the conveyor line to the recycling station.

[0047] 4. Recycling Stage: When qualified medicine tubes arrive at the recycling station at the end of the conveyor line, the vision positioning component of the spider arm at the recycling end collects the position data of the medicine tubes and guides the robot to move above the V-shaped groove. The pneumatic gripper smoothly picks up the medicine tubes and then puts them into the anti-static qualified product recycling box. When the box is full, the human-machine interface issues a prompt signal to remind the staff to wear anti-static gloves to replace the box. 5. Cyclic Operation Phase: Each mechanism operates continuously according to the above process, with feeding, conveying, detection, rejection, and recycling carried out simultaneously. The control system monitors the status of each workstation's medicine tubes in real time through position sensors, enabling parallel processing of multiple medicine tubes and improving overall detection efficiency. When equipment malfunctions, the silo is short of material, or an abnormal pressure signal is detected, the alarm indicator light illuminates, the equipment automatically stops, and the cause of the malfunction is displayed on the human-machine interface, while the safety protection program is activated.

[0071] The conveyor line mechanism is a conveyor belt structure, including a frame on which a conveyor belt is mounted. The conveyor belt operates in a rotary manner, meaning it rotates around the frame. Pallets are mounted on the conveyor belt, consisting of two vertically arranged plate structures. Pallets are grouped in pairs, with the two pallets in each group positioned on opposite sides of the conveyor belt. V-shaped grooves are provided on the pallets for placing vials of medicine. The vials near their ends can be secured to the two pallets in the same group. This ensures the stability of the vials on the pallets and maximizes the exposure of the surface structure, guaranteeing the reliability of the inspection data obtained by the visual inspection agency. Furthermore, when the conveyor line mechanism consists of multiple conveyor belts, it facilitates the connection between adjacent conveyor belts. For example, the upstream conveyor belt can be set at a slightly higher height, and the downstream conveyor belt at a slightly lower height, with their ends joined together. When the upstream conveyor belt rotates, the vials descend and are caught by the pallets on the downstream conveyor belt, thus completing the transfer of the vials.

[0072] The present invention provides a robotic arm for transferring tubular medicine from the medicine box (silo) to the conveyor line mechanism. In a specific embodiment of the present invention, the robotic arm includes two structural forms: 1. The robotic arm includes a multi-axis robot, with a spider arm at the end of the multi-axis robot for grasping the tubular medicine; 2. The robotic arm includes a gantry frame, which is horizontally arranged above the conveyor line mechanism. A crane is installed on the gantry frame, and a lifting device is installed on the crane. At the end of the lifting device, a negative pressure suction cup is installed to grasp the tubular medicine by negative pressure adsorption.

[0073] During the inspection process, the medicine tubes are placed on the pallets of the conveyor mechanism. To reduce the difficulty of operating the robotic arm (if the robotic arm is used to place the medicine tubes one by one and stably onto the pallets, the requirements for the robotic arm's motion precision and control capability will be very high), this invention also provides a sorting conveyor belt. The robotic arm only needs to take the medicine tubes out of the medicine box and place them on the sorting conveyor belt. An adjustable limit plate with an adjustable width is provided at the end of the sorting conveyor belt to adjust the posture of the medicine tubes so that the medicine tubes can be transported in a set posture. A slide plate is connected to the sorting conveyor belt. The slide plate is connected to the conveyor mechanism. The end of the slide plate corresponds to the pallet. After the medicine tubes slide off the slide plate, they can fall directly onto the pallet.

[0074] The visual inspection structure can detect the appearance, concentricity, cuts and length of the tube. For each type of inspection, the present invention is provided with a corresponding inspection unit.

[0075] Specifically, the visual inspection structure includes an appearance inspection unit, which in turn includes at least three industrial cameras. Within the same group of appearance inspection units, all industrial cameras are equally spaced around the axis of the tube being inspected. The appearance inspection unit also includes a mounting frame, which is fixedly mounted on a machine frame. The mounting frame includes four mounting axes (the four mounting axes are mounted on the machine frame via X-shaped mounting plates; two mounting plates are provided, one on each side of the conveyor belt). The four mounting axes are equally spaced around the axis of the tube being inspected in a front-up, front-down, rear-up, and rear-down configuration. The industrial cameras are mounted on the mounting axes using clamps or similar structures.

[0076] Specifically, the visual inspection structure includes a concentricity detection unit, which comprises an industrial camera and a telecentric eight-eighths-inch lens used in conjunction with the industrial camera. The concentricity detection unit is used to acquire images of the tube end face and calculate the concentricity based on the contours of the outer circle and inner core of the tube. Further, in this invention, the concentricity detection unit is fixedly disposed on one side of the conveyor belt mechanism. This invention can also include a circular calibration component between the concentricity detection unit and the tube. Both the calibration component and the concentricity detection unit are fixedly disposed on one side of the conveyor belt mechanism. The calibration component is a standard circular ring structure. When the concentricity detection unit takes a picture, both the calibration component and the tube are within the field of view of the concentricity detection unit. The calibration component can provide a standard coordinate system for calculating the concentricity of the tube (e.g., the circle of the calibration component is the origin; the center of the tube is calculated based on the pixel position through image analysis), thereby facilitating the calculation.

[0077] Specifically, the visual inspection structure includes a cut detection unit, which comprises an industrial camera and an octet lens used in conjunction with the industrial camera. The cut detection unit is used to acquire the flatness, smoothness, cut angle, and cut shape parameters of the drug delivery cut. Like the concentricity detection unit, the cut detection unit is fixedly installed on one side of the conveyor mechanism.

[0078] Specifically, the visual inspection structure includes a length detection unit, which includes a height adjustment frame, an industrial camera mounted on the height adjustment frame, and a telecentric lens used in conjunction with the industrial camera. The length detection unit is used to acquire tube images from top to bottom and determine the length of the tube by analyzing the pixel information in the image.

[0079] Specifically, the recovery end of the conveyor mechanism is equipped with an inclined track, and a recovery belt is installed below the inclined track. When qualified products on the conveyor mechanism reach the recovery end, they will detach from the pallet as the conveyor mechanism rotates and fall onto the recovery belt. The recovery belt then transports the tubing to the qualified product hopper, where it is transferred by a robotic arm. Parallel to the inclined track is a rejection track, which is a liftable structure. When the tubing on the conveyor mechanism is qualified, the rejection track is raised, moving away from the conveying trajectory of the tubing, allowing it to fall smoothly onto the recovery belt. When the tubing on the conveyor mechanism is unqualified, the rejection track is lowered, intervening in the conveying trajectory of the tubing. As the conveyor mechanism rotates, the tubing can contact and be caught by the rejection track, allowing it to slide down into the rejection area.
